title = "Magnetic field analysis of the realistic head model based on transcranial magnetic stimulation",
abstract = "Transcranial magnetic stimulation (TMS) is a powerful, noninvasive tool for investigating functions in the brain. The target inside the head is stimulated with eddy currents induced in the tissue by the time-varying magnetic field. In this paper, a realistic head model used in FEM has been developed. The magnetic field induced in the head by TMS has been analyzed. The results are useful for the optimization of coil current magnitude, configuration and location.",
